BOSTON – Matthew Larkin has joined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center (BIDMC) as Chief Operating Officer (COO). Larkin will oversee key strategies for directing and administering operations across the medical center in support of BIDMC’s mission to provide extraordinary care where the patient comes first supported by world-class education and research.

“Matthew is an exceptional, thoughtful leader who is an outstanding fit for this important role,” said Pete Healy, president of BIDMC. “His depth of expertise in health care leadership will be an invaluable asset for our organization. We are thrilled to welcome him to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center.”

Larkin has more than 18 years of leadership experience in health care. Most recently, he served as COO of Portsmouth Regional Hospital in New Hampshire, where he led many complex projects, including the initiation of a major radiation oncology project, and the development of an in-house ambulance service. Larkin previously served as senior vice president of operations for the Tufts Medical Center Physicians Organization.

“I’m excited to join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center,” said Larkin. “I look forward to collaborating with remarkable colleagues across the organization to support BIDMC in providing high-quality patient care and exceptional patient and family experiences.”

Larkin earned his Bachelor of Arts degree in health care administration at Stonehill College and Master of Business Administration degree from Boston University.

About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center

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center is a leading academic medical center, where extraordinary care is supported by high-quality education and research. BIDMC is a teaching affiliate of Harvard Medical School, and consistently ranks as a national leader among independent hospitals in National Institutes of Health funding. BIDMC is the official hospital of the Boston Red Sox.

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center is a part of Beth Israel Lahey Health, a health care system that brings together academic medical centers and teaching hospitals, community and specialty hospitals, more than 4,700 physicians and 39,000 employees in a shared mission to expand access to great care and advance the science and practice of medicine through groundbreaking research and education.
